What to check before for buildings near subway lines in Saint George

  • Check the exact stop and walking time from each building, since “near subway lines” can still mean different block distances.
  • Confirm the building’s current availability of apartments and review any move-in requirements (income/verification docs, application steps).
  • Match your commute needs to line schedules and service changes, not just map distance.
  • Before you apply, ask for the full move-in cost breakdown: deposit, broker fee (if any), and utility responsibilities.
  • If a building has recent updates or issues noted in tenant Q&A, request documentation or clarify timelines in writing.
